Offer Description

In the frame of the joint-lab IRP-CNRS “FiberMed” between XLIM research institute and the Translational Biophotonics Laboratory (A*STAR Skin Research Labs, Singapore), we are developing novel biosensing probes based on (specially designed) optofluidic fibers associated with plasmonic nanotechnologies and novel biosensing strategies, with the aim of creating new diagnostic tools for liquid biopsy.
You will be in charge of:
- the development of detection methods of biomarkers (proteins, nucleic acids) in more or less complex biological fluids, based on the use of biosensors (antibodies, DNA probes, etc.) and the spectroscopy Raman-SERS, or fluorescence or by plasmon resonance.
And/or
- increasing the biosensing performances of the optofluidic fiber probes by improving plasmonic interactions, the properties of the optical fibers (fabrication of new optofluidic fibers), the functionalization of these fibers, and the spectroscopy benches (Raman-SERS or fluorescence).
You will be also in charge of co-supervising student interns, and of collaborating with our biologist collaborators involved in this multidisciplinary project.

This post-doc takes place within the framework of the Franco-Singaporean FUNSENS project funded by the ANR. The successful candidate will be attached to the XLIM research institute under the dual supervision of the CNRS and the University of Limoges. He (She) will join the “Phot-fibre” team in the “Fiber photonics and coherent photonic sources” axis. He (She) will collaborate with colleagues from A*STAR Singapore and the CAPTUR laboratory (Inserm, Limoges University Hospital, University of Limoges).
